Where is Kāmalāpuram?
Where is Kāmalāpuram located?
Kāmalāpuram, Kāmalāpuram, India (approx. 14.596293°, 78.67042°)
Where is Kāmalāpuram on the map?
{"latitude":14.596293,"longitude":78.67042,"title":"Kāmalāpuram"}